In recent decades, authors affiliated with Assiut University have published 24.0k papers, which have received a total of 358.9k indexed citations. Scholars at this organization have produced 2.6k papers in Molecular Biology, 2.3k papers in Plant Science and 2.3k papers in Materials Chemistry on the topics of Synthesis and biological activity (796 papers), Synthesis and Characterization of Heterocyclic Compounds (522 papers) and Electrochemical Analysis and Applications (375 papers). Their work is cited by papers focused on Materials Chemistry (51.1k citations), Molecular Biology (42.5k citations) and Biomedical Engineering (37.3k citations). Authors at Assiut University collaborate with scholars in Egypt, Saudi Arabia and United States and have published in prestigious journals including Nature, Science and Proceedings of the National Academy of Sciences. Some of Assiut University's most productive authors include Hani Nasser Abdelhamid, Hamdy Hassan, Mohamed Abou‐Elwafa Abdallah, Stuart Harrad, Eman M. Khedr, Mahmoud Elsabahy, Sherifa A. Hamed, Mahmoud F. Fathalla, Karen L. Wooley and Mahmoud Ahmed.
